I'd start M-y with the first entry of the kill-ring.  It would
probably make M-y more popular than C-y, but people might learn to
live with that.  It would probably also make sense to have C-y accept
a multiplier argument (probably more expected) while letting M-y
accept a stack pointer argument.

So if you were certain to need only the most recent kill, you'd use
C-y, and if you _might_ want a different kill, you'd use M-y.
